Methods of treating body aches are simple, whether they are caused by muscle strain, arthritis, illness, or a chronic disease like fibromyalgia. For short-term body aches, your body just needs time to heal or recover from an illness. For chronic pain, the key is learning to manage the pain.
If the body aches are due to strenuous exercise, either do a very light workout until your muscles feel better, or do some other kind of exercise that won’t further stress those muscles until they heal. Massage can help the muscles to relax and temporarily relieve body aches. Taking a warm bath, or using a heating pad on the area most affected by the aches can also have the same effect.

Skeletal muscle accounts for 40% of body weight, and about 85% of human pain complaints. The commonest muscles affected, in those seen in the pain clinic, are those in the neck, shoulder girdle, low back and hip
girdle.

Most foot pain is caused by shoes that do not fit properly or that force the feet into unnatural shapes, rest will allow the tissues to heal by preventing any further stress to the affected area.
When the shoe is on and you’re standing up, make sure you can fit the width of your little finger between your heel and the back of the shoe, proper support for arches or rotation of shoe types will alleviate the pain.

Foot pain can be treated at home with rest and ice. Rest will allow the tissues to heal themselves by preventing any further stress to the affected area. Ice should be applied no longer than 20 minutes. The ice may be put in a plastic bag or wrapped in a towel.

Chiropractic back pain treatment has traditionally been based on spinal manipulation, which generally involves applying a manual, controlled force into joints that have become restricted by tissue injury with the purpose of restoring the joint’s mobility, alleviating related pain and tightness, and allowing the tissues to heal.

While acute pain is a normal sensation triggered in the nervous system to alert you to possible injury and the need to take care of yourself, chronic pain is different. Chronic pain persists. Pain signals keep firing in the nervous system for weeks, months, even years.
There may have been an initial mishap, sprained back, serious infection, or there may be an ongoing cause of pain, arthritis, cancer, ear infection, but some people suffer chronic pain in the absence of any past injury or evidence of body damage. Many chronic pain conditions affect older adults. Common chronic pain complaints include headache, low back pain, cancer pain, arthritis pain, neurogenic pain.
